Ingredients :
• 2 pounds ground beef
• 1 cup breadcrumbs
• 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
• 1/4 cup milk
• 2 eggs
• 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
• 1 teaspoon salt
• 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
• 2 large onions, thinly sliced
• 2 tablespoons butter
• 1 cup beef broth
• 8 slices Swiss cheese
Directions :
1️⃣ Prepare the Meat Mixture:
In a large bowl, mix together the ground beef, bre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, milk, eggs,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per. Combine thoroughly until all ingredients are evenly incorporated.
2️⃣ Form the Loaf:
Shape the beef mixture into a loaf form. Place the loaf carefully in your crockpot.
3️⃣ Caramelize the Onions:
Melt butter in a skillet over medium heat. Add the thinly sliced onions and cook them slowly, stirring occasionally, until they become caramelized, which takes about 20-25 minutes. Once caramelized, pour in the beef broth and continue cooking until most of the liquid is absorbed.
4️⃣ Add Onions to the Meatloaf:
Pour the caramelized onions with broth over the meatloaf in the crockpot.
5️⃣ Slow Cook the Meatloaf:
Set the crockpot to low and cook the meatloaf for 6 to 8 hours, or until it reaches the desired doneness.
6️⃣ Melt the Cheese:
About 10 minutes before serving, lay Swiss cheese slices over the top of the meatloaf. Cover and allow the cheese to melt.
7️⃣ Serve and Enjoy:
Serve the meatloaf hot, sliced with the gooey melted cheese on top, and enjoy the rich, savory flavors!
